ok here is my step by step of what im doing,

start my car
pulg in my usb to com 6, thats where my driver loaded
open turbo edit
goto file, open, my ng60 bin
Go to tools, options, comunications, set dataloging to com6, set rtp to com 1, baud rate to 38400 apply and close
then I go to File, Dataloging
click conect, start loging.

thats where it ends.
nothing happens on my screen, but the green light on my cable bilnks green.
